Energy Efficiency: Wood stoves can be highly efficient at heating homes, especially in areas where wood is abundant and relatively inexpensive compared to other fuel sources.

Cost Savings: Using wood as a fuel source can often be cheaper than electricity, gas, or oil, providing potential cost savings over time.

Independence: Wood stoves offer independence from centralized heating systems, making them ideal for rural areas or off-grid living.

Ambiance: Wood stoves provide a cozy ambiance and can create a warm focal point in a room, enhancing the atmosphere of a home.

Backup Heating: They can serve as a backup heating source during power outages, ensuring that you can stay warm even when the electricity is down.

Sustainability: Burning wood can be considered more environmentally friendly than some fossil fuel alternatives, especially if the wood is sourced sustainably from managed forests.Reduced Carbon Footprint: Modern wood stoves are designed to burn wood more efficiently, reducing emissions and minimizing their impact on the environment compared to older models.
